Key Artists and Anthems
Alright, let's get into some of the key players and unforgettable anthems that defined musica de baile portuguesa anos 80. You can't talk about this era without mentioning Rui Veloso. His blend of blues, rock, and Portuguese folk music created a unique sound that resonated deeply with audiences. Songs like "Chico Fininho" are still classics today, showcasing his incredible guitar skills and soulful voice. Then there's Heróis do Mar, with their new wave and synth-pop vibes. Their hit "Amor" is an absolute dance floor filler, known for its catchy melody and infectious energy. And of course, Xutos & Pontapés, the kings of Portuguese rock, brought their rebellious spirit and powerful sound to the dance scene with tracks like "À Minha Maneira."
Beyond these iconic figures, there were countless other artists who contributed to the rich tapestry of musica de baile portuguesa anos 80. Lena D’Água brought her avant-garde style and theatrical flair to the scene, creating songs that were both thought-provoking and danceable. Paulo de Carvalho, a veteran of Portuguese music, continued to evolve with the times, incorporating new sounds and styles into his repertoire. And let's not forget José Cid, whose experimental and progressive approach to music made him a true visionary.
